3e4a604739 
								
							 
						 
						
							
							
								
								refactor: move git status request to project_manager  
							
							
							
						 
						
							2025-10-28 21:31:32 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								e053a0dcf4 
								
							 
						 
						
							
							
								
								fix: normalize away './' path prefixes  
							
							
							
						 
						
							2025-10-23 23:24:58 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								b30b0a69bd 
								
							 
						 
						
							
							
								
								build: move test-filter build parameter to fix release builds  
							
							
							
						 
						
							2025-10-10 09:40:38 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Igor Támara 
								
							 
						 
						
							
							
							
							
								
							
							
								a6f5ffcdc5 
								
							 
						 
						
							
							
								
								hx: add tests for some Helix mode movements  
							
							
							
						 
						
							2025-10-10 09:35:44 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
							
							
								
							
							
								a5dc6d8a43 
								
							 
						 
						
							
							
								
								fix: build of helix_mode tests  
							
							
							
						 
						
							2025-10-10 09:35:44 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Igor Támara 
								
							 
						 
						
							
							
							
							
								
							
							
								a64d7c3afa 
								
							 
						 
						
							
							
								
								hx: attempt to add tests in separate file  
							
							
							
						 
						
							2025-10-10 09:35:44 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								632654c2a4 
								
							 
						 
						
							
							
								
								fix: windows build  
							
							
							
						 
						
							2025-10-08 21:12:43 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								3c55ed876b 
								
							 
						 
						
							
							
								
								refactor: allow mocking of root module functions for easier unittesting  
							
							
							
						 
						
							2025-10-08 14:18:03 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								cc9b002778 
								
							 
						 
						
							
							
								
								feat: add freebsd to binary release builds  
							
							
							
						 
						
							2025-10-02 14:04:35 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								b7b0501715 
								
							 
						 
						
							
							
								
								fix: support -Dtarget=[target] for release builds  
							
							... 
							
							
							
							Specifying a target will still produce a baseline cpu release build. 
							
						 
						
							2025-10-02 10:29:47 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								31c03060cf 
								
							 
						 
						
							
							
								
								build: add -Dall_targets build option to build all known good release targets  
							
							... 
							
							
							
							Now just plain `--release` will build the release just for the native cpu arch and os.
Adding `-Dall_targets` will build all targets in the known good list.
closes  #311  
							
						 
						
							2025-10-02 09:55:35 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								24bca6d516 
								
							 
						 
						
							
							
								
								fix: re-enable win32 release builds  
							
							... 
							
							
							
							closes  #308  
						
							2025-10-01 17:00:47 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								30ad3aea60 
								
							 
						 
						
							
							
								
								feat: minor tweaks to version info  
							
							
							
						 
						
							2025-09-30 15:50:17 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								8fb29416f3 
								
							 
						 
						
							
							
								
								build: use the same optimization level for regular and debuginfo builds  
							
							
							
						 
						
							2025-09-30 10:48:39 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								f5bfcd9219 
								
							 
						 
						
							
							
								
								build: use standard --release flag for building releases  
							
							
							
						 
						
							2025-09-30 10:48:15 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								f795eb71fc 
								
							 
						 
						
							
							
								
								fix: unbreak macos release builds  
							
							
							
						 
						
							2025-09-30 10:43:34 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								716fd480cb 
								
							 
						 
						
							
							
								
								fix: enable llvm by default for debug builds  
							
							... 
							
							
							
							The native backends for zig are still very slow. Enable llvm by default so debug
builds are generally useable. For quick builds, explicitly disable llvm with
`-Duse_llvm=false`. 
							
						 
						
							2025-09-30 09:55:18 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								5c844410ff 
								
							 
						 
						
							
							
								
								build: disable windows builds until fixed  
							
							
							
						 
						
							2025-09-29 22:59:10 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								e558502ea2 
								
							 
						 
						
							
							
								
								refactor: port to writergate  
							
							
							
						 
						
							2025-08-22 14:26:42 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								b6d4935303 
								
							 
						 
						
							
							
								
								build: update build to zig-0.15.1  
							
							
							
						 
						
							2025-08-22 13:16:20 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								991c47f3b3 
								
							 
						 
						
							
							
								
								feat: restore buffer manager state on restart  
							
							
							
						 
						
							2025-08-07 18:02:55 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								6df9391b50 
								
							 
						 
						
							
							
								
								feat: make project_manager use configurable file types  
							
							
							
						 
						
							2025-07-14 18:02:23 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								bffc56b618 
								
							 
						 
						
							
							
								
								feat: port editor to use configurable file types  
							
							
							
						 
						
							2025-07-14 18:02:23 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								2897d8d745 
								
							 
						 
						
							
							
								
								feat: add command to edit file type configuration files  
							
							
							
						 
						
							2025-07-14 18:02:22 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								717bef9c61 
								
							 
						 
						
							
							
								
								build: update to latest libvaxis and zg api  
							
							
							
						 
						
							2025-06-04 22:22:52 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								2412dd36e6 
								
							 
						 
						
							
							
								
								build(nightly): use ReleaseFast for release builds and ReleaseSafe for debug builds  
							
							
							
						 
						
							2025-05-20 14:49:52 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								cb399a4c73 
								
							 
						 
						
							
							
								
								build: add debug info builds to release process  
							
							
							
						 
						
							2025-05-14 17:57:07 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								8426ae61ba 
								
							 
						 
						
							
							
								
								build: switch release builds back to ReleaseSafe  
							
							
							
						 
						
							2025-05-14 16:48:03 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								ce2c370cfd 
								
							 
						 
						
							
							
								
								fix: add missing bin_path module  
							
							
							
						 
						
							2025-04-30 09:59:30 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								f76085325a 
								
							 
						 
						
							
							
								
								feat: query project files via git (part 1)  
							
							
							
						 
						
							2025-04-21 21:43:29 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								3c4f40f16c 
								
							 
						 
						
							
							
								
								fix: check target  
							
							
							
						 
						
							2025-04-21 13:37:26 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								845403f2ae 
								
							 
						 
						
							
							
								
								refactor: make bin_path a module  
							
							
							
						 
						
							2025-04-20 18:56:06 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								5ad074c681 
								
							 
						 
						
							
							
								
								feat: start git client module  
							
							
							
						 
						
							2025-04-19 23:41:30 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								c3cda5b7fe 
								
							 
						 
						
							
							
								
								build: update thespian to use separate cbor package  
							
							
							
						 
						
							2025-03-26 20:41:44 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								4283321542 
								
							 
						 
						
							
							
								
								feat: add build version to home screen  
							
							
							
						 
						
							2025-03-26 19:09:49 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								670f671713 
								
							 
						 
						
							
							
								
								build: enable ReleaseFast for release builds  
							
							
							
						 
						
							2025-03-06 17:36:59 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								f29e01f244 
								
							 
						 
						
							
							
								
								build: re-enable the zig fmt linting build step  
							
							
							
						 
						
							2025-03-05 21:44:45 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								34afb46078 
								
							 
						 
						
							
							
								
								build: get tracy dependency indirectly from thespian  
							
							
							
						 
						
							2025-03-05 11:02:18 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								1acee03ea9 
								
							 
						 
						
							
							
								
								feat(version): add timestamp of last commit to version info  
							
							
							
						 
						
							2025-03-04 18:49:18 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								fb5cd46d0b 
								
							 
						 
						
							
							
								
								fix: check target missing color module  
							
							
							
						 
						
							2025-02-12 18:17:43 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								9f2e3bf4b4 
								
							 
						 
						
							
							
								
								fix: load case data early on startup instead of on demand  
							
							... 
							
							
							
							This is to avoid an issue with the decompressor causing heap
corruption on macos.
closes  #169  
							
						 
						
							2025-02-12 18:13:07 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								d6ff940fb7 
								
							 
						 
						
							
							
								
								feat(list-languages): add colored file type icons  
							
							
							
						 
						
							2025-02-11 14:40:45 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								868fc4faea 
								
							 
						 
						
							
							
								
								fix: use correct build mode in version info  
							
							
							
						 
						
							2025-02-06 22:18:11 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								5f41ec12dc 
								
							 
						 
						
							
							
								
								feat: add zig version and build mode to version info  
							
							
							
						 
						
							2025-02-06 21:44:25 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								7f99dc4733 
								
							 
						 
						
							
							
								
								fix: allow get_version_info to succeed if git rev-parse fails  
							
							... 
							
							
							
							closes  #167  
						
							2025-02-05 18:08:52 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								4d3d91a744 
								
							 
						 
						
							
							
								
								feat(buffers): add support for buffer references  
							
							
							
						 
						
							2025-01-26 21:06:51 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								0f6be55dbd 
								
							 
						 
						
							
							
								
								refactor: improve usefullness of trace-level 1  
							
							
							
						 
						
							2025-01-26 17:01:33 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
						 
						
							
							
								
								
									
										
									
								
							
							
							
								
							
							
								8a89c888eb 
								
							 
						 
						
							
							
								
								fix: keybind testcases  
							
							
							
						 
						
							2025-01-22 22:31:55 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Meredith Oleander 
								
							 
						 
						
							
							
								
								
							
							
							
								
							
							
								80c8795c3b 
								
							 
						 
						
							
							
								
								Merge branch 'master' into helix-mode-selections  
							
							
							
						 
						
							2025-01-22 13:47:37 +11: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Jonathan Marler 
								
							 
						 
						
							
							
							
							
								
							
							
								99aefc8d22 
								
							 
						 
						
							
							
								
								remove direct2d dependency and update zigwin32  
							
							... 
							
							
							
							Since we removed the direct2d renderer we no longer need to reference
the direct2d-zig repository.  Instead we now directly reference the
zigwin32 repository.  I've also updated that repository with a few fixes
and additions which allowed us to remove some code from flow. 
							
						 
						
							2025-01-21 08:40:44 +01:00